To give you the best help, we need some info about the systems and connections involved. Post back and give as much as possible of the information requested in the the When do I Post a New iChat Topic ? FAQ, starting about half way down the page.

By my count, the list requests 19 items of information. You should give the info for EACH system involved. (You may even find the problem in the process of gathering that info.)

In addition, let us know that your OS X Maintenance is up to date, whether you have EVER had a successful video chat on your system, and what (if anything) has changed since then. We will be happy to try to provide more specific responses based on your additional info.





However, if you want to try some things on your own first, here are some ideas.

First, be certain you can meet Apple's stated System Requirements for iChat AV 3

If you need more help than iChat > Help > iChat Help on your Mac gives you, check out the iChat AV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).

Although these FAQs were written for iChat AV 2.1, the process is VERY similar in iChat AV 3, but some features and menu commands have changed slightly. The FAQs may not be updated for iChat AV 3 for a while because we are still learning so much.

Start with What do I need to start in iChat ? FAQ.

If you use a router, try enabling its UP-n-P feature. If that does not help, see the How can I get my router to work with iChat? FAQ for further help with configuration.

For additional router info, also see Ralph Johns' GREAT iChat web pages. The sections on Router Set Up and the menu and sub-menu items titled "Setting Up Your Router" and "Eliminating Problem areas" will give you a lot of useful info. (You may want to bookmark Ralph's entire site as a primary iChat AV reference.)

You might also want to review Ralph Johns' current Trouble Shooting thread and Apple's Tiger Support page.

If you are having other problems with your Mac after your Tiger install, Apple's Troubleshooting Mac OS X installation from CD or DVD article may give you some ideas.
